Recipes Missing From Vanilla Behavior Pack
Several crafting recipes are unable to be overwritten as they do not appear in the recipes folder in the vanilla behavior files.
The most obvious ones are any recipe involving all overworld planks (oak, spruce, birch, jungle, acacia or dark oak), I assume because they have multiple data values for 1 block but I'm not sure.
I also assume that there are many other recipes that are unavailable as well, not just plank related ones.
Steps To Reproduce:
- Either download the Vanilla Behavior pack or navigate to C:\Program Files\WindowsApps\ then go to one of the MinecraftUWP folders (stable or beta).
- Go to data\behavior_packs then go to vanilla or the latest vanilla_1.16 folder
- Go to recipes and look for recipes like crafting table, bookshelf, chest, wooden_sword, etc. (Anything that can be crafted using any of the overworld planks)
- The recipes aren't available
Expected Behavior:
- All recipes are available to be overwritten
Actual Behavior:
- Several recipes are missing

can confirm, other examples include pistons and bookshelves
This happens due to the fact that the first 6 types of planks (oak, spruce, birch, jungle, acacia and dark oak) have one identifier ("minecraft:planks"). For this reason, you can combine different planks in one recipe, if no data value is specified. This does not apply to new blocks (crimson, warped and mangrove planks), since these blocks have their own unique identifier, and each of these options has its own separate recipe. The same thing happens with different data values for "minecraft:stone".
